Predictive importance of ulceration on the efficacy of adjuvant interferon-a (IFN): An individual patient data (IPD) meta-analysis of 15 randomized trials in more than 7,500 melanoma patients (pts).

9067 Background: Many randomised trials have evaluated the role of adjuvant IFN in high-risk melanoma, some suggesting benefit and others not. To assess the evidence of IFN vs. no IFN, an IPD meta-analysis of these trials was performed. Methods: Standard IPD meta-analysis methods were used to assess event-free (EFS) and overall survival (OS), with odds ratios (OR) and confidence intervals (CI) calculated. Trials were divided by dose of IFN - high (10-20MU/m2), Peg-IFN (3-6{micro}g/Kg), intermediate (5-10MU flat), low (3MU flat) and very low (1MU). Results: IPD was provided for 11 of 15 reported trials of IFN vs. no IFN (for the other 4 trials published data were used).
